Revamping Breakfast with Yogurt
Let’s start with the most important meal of the day. When you think of yogurt, smoothies or parfaits might come to mind first. Consider yogurt bowls that incorporate fruits, nuts, and a crunch element like granola. The thick texture of Greek yogurt makes it perfect for ensuring you feel full longer, providing that needed energy boost to kickstart your day.
Join the trend of overnight oats, a convenient make-ahead breakfast. Mix yogurt with rolled oats, a splash of milk, and whatever fruits and spices you prefer. The oats soak up the yogurt, resulting in a creamy and satisfying breakfast—no cooking required.
Lunch and Dinner—Making Meals with Yogurt
Yogurt isn’t just for breakfast! Use it to make creamy and delicious marinades for chicken or fish. The acidity in yogurt breaks down meat fibers, yielding tender, flavorful dishes. Popular marinades combine yogurt with spices like curry or herbs like dill for a Mediterranean flair.
Don’t forget about dips! Homemade tzatziki is a quick mix of grated cucumber, yogurt, garlic, and dill, making for a refreshing companion to grilled meats or pita.
Yogurt's Sweet Side: Desserts and Snacks
For those with a sweet tooth, yogurt paves the way for healthier desserts. Create frozen yogurt bark by spreading yogurt over a lined baking sheet and topping it with fruit and nuts before freezing. The result is a creamy, indulgent treat that’s guilt-free.
Consider layering yogurt with favorite fruits and granola in parfaits, or make yogurt popsicles by blending yogurt with fruit juice. Both satisfy sweet cravings while adding a nutritional punch.
